The suggestion to try to get a cardboard template is a wise one which I recommend you jump at.
The framing is a lot more particular than it first appears and there are clearance issues for hull access etc on the seat base.
Try as you might and as good as you may be, if you can follow a template keeping to OEM design you preserve the appearance, functionality and future vakue of your boat.
